New Tropical Destination Available From Toronto This Winter

If you’re looking for a new beach getaway destination to escape Mississauga this winter, you’re in luck!
Sunwing is expanding its roster of tropical destinations from Toronto for the winter, and Cayo Largo, Cuba, is their most recent addition.
Sunwing is expected to be the only carrier to offer a flight between Toronto and Cayo Largo for the winter, a flight which will operate on Fridays between December 15, 2017, and April 13, 2018.
Cayo Largo is just off the coast of the Cuban mainland, with over 25 kilometres of beaches and 32 diving sites.
The island also has rich heritage, with over 20 sunken ships dating back to the 16th and 18th centuries, some of which can be explored on diving excursions.
As for accommodation packages on the island through Sunwing, there are bungalows resting on stilts at Sol Cayo Largo, calm, shallow waters at Hotel Pelicano, Playa Sirena beach near Iberostar Playa Blanca, and a more private, quiet vibe and a white-sand beach at Villa Iguana.
Sunwing now offers eight destinations from Toronto for the winter.
